PITTSBURGH, May 9 (UPI) -- The Pittsburgh Penguins took the lead in their Eastern Conference semifinal Saturday with a 2-1 win over the Montreal Canadiens.
Sergei Gonchar and Kris Letang scored for the Penguins and Canadien Michael Cammalleri got the Montreal goal, fouling Penguin goalie Marc-Andre Fleury's chance of a shutout in the final minute. Fleury blocked 32 shots in the win.
